Meet Ella!

ELLA COOPER is an award winning producer, multimedia artist, educator, writer and director based in Toronto who has been working in the arts, film and cultural sector for over 20 years.

Ella is founder of Black Women Film! Canada a not for profit supporting the development of Black women in film and media.

She started Brown Rabbit Studios in 2020, a new BIPOC production company focused on content creation for tv, arts and children programming with a new animation in development with CBC Kids & Karen Chapman. She is currently a writer/director for a new TVO Kids show ‘Sunny’s Quest,’ and has been nominated for a 2023 Canadian Screen award for this work.

Ella received the Tiffany’s Hometown Hero Award and was nominated for the 2019 TAC Mayor's Arts Award for cultural leadership and featured as one of 33 Black Canadians Making Change Now in Chatelaine magazine. Her photo series ‘Witness’ was just selected as 2020 Editors Pick in Canadian Art Magazine and her documentary, dance and video installation works have been presented in galleries, public spaces and film festivals in Toronto, Vancouver, Winnipeg, Calgary, Los Angeles, San Francisco, Amsterdam and Berlin. She was an artist in residence at the Banff Centre, Picture Berlin and is supported by the Ontario, Toronto & Canada Arts Councils.

Ella is also holds a Masters of Education and known for her speaking, facilitation, teaching and transformative leadership programs created for diverse communities internationally and across Canada.
